Eunice Spalding Adams was born in 1713 in Canterbury, CT, the child of Joseph Adams And Eunice Spaulding. Eunice Spalding Adams married Thomas Bradford, and had children including James Bradford, John Bradford, Lydia Bradford, Samuel Bradford, Susanna Bradford, Thomas Bradford, Unice Bradford. Eunice Spalding Adams passed away in 1804 in Canterbury, CT.
